looks great, trace! thanks for sharing. love those local veges too and i usually cook "laswa" here every week during the summer. my fave "laswa" is saluyot with okra, kalabasa, bamboo shoots and talong with organic bragg seasoning instead of fish sauce (which lowers the sodium content). that combo is good for cleansing as well since saluyot or jute leaves, okra and bamboo shoots are rich in fiber. my mom keeps an organic garden in her backyard and has all the veges mentioned in the "bahay kubo" song haha... and i usually ship them via priority mail to ilonggo friends in other cities/states. malunggay is one of the most nutritious greens there is and saluyot is an ancient anecdote to wrinkles favored by cleopatra herself. let's just eat those greens and say goodbye to anti-wrinkle creams ;)
